_Increasingly around the world, banks are starting to outsource core business operations to specialist third parties. Rune Sørensen, Product Manager, Card Processing Services, Nets, explains how the Nordics are a case study in how this process can lead to increased agility._

> The Nordic countries constitute the most advanced and digitally ready payment market in Europe, and one of the most advanced in the world [\[1\]](https://mail.google.com/mail/u/1/#m_-987061925572905575__ftn1).

The penetration of card, contactless card and mobile payments is high, and the race to be the world’s first cashless country is essentially a competition between Norway, Sweden, Finland and Denmark. One of the ruling parties in Norway’s coalition government has suggested that this will be achieved in Norway by 2030 [\[2\]](https://mail.google.com/mail/u/1/#m_-987061925572905575__ftn2), and the Swedish Retail and Wholesale Council (Handelsrådet) estimates that Swedish merchants will stop accepting cash payments as early as 2023 [\[3\]](https://mail.google.com/mail/u/1/#m_-987061925572905575__ftn3).

One reason for the advanced [digital readiness](https://www.financedigest.com/an-analysis-of-vc-investment-in-the-defence-sector-and-the-mods-readiness-to-exploit-digital-opportunities.html "An analysis of VC investment in the Defence sector and the MOD’s readiness to exploit digital opportunities") of consumers in the region is Nordic issuers’ determination to be customer oriented and forward-thinking. They understand that the battle for present and future [market share will be won by adding convenience and value](https://www.financedigest.com/rare-neurodegenerative-disease-treatment-market-value-share-supply-demand-share-and-value-chain-2021-2031.html "Rare Neurodegenerative Disease Treatment Market Value Share, Supply Demand, share and Value Chain 2021-2031") to consumer’s daily lives, especially as competition has intensified further with the second Payment Service Directive (PSD2), which is opening up the marketplace to new players. All of this requires issuers to retain a laser-like [focus on innovation](https://www.financedigest.com/maximising-the-opportunities-available-from-marketing-technology-and-innovation-focused-thinking.html "Maximising the opportunities available from marketing technology and innovation focused thinking") and the user experience.

**So, why are the Nordics different?**

50 years ago, [banks across the Nordics began to realise that they could significantly reduce their costs through collaboration](https://www.financedigest.com/why-open-banking-heralds-a-new-era-of-ecommerce-merchant-and-bank-collaboration.html "Why Open Banking Heralds a New Era of eCommerce Merchant and Bank Collaboration"). Danish banks were the first to act on this opportunity by developing a shared payments infrastructure, and over the [next few years](https://www.financedigest.com/uaes-adnoc-to-open-swiss-trading-office-next-year.html "UAE’s ADNOC to open Swiss trading office next year") Norway and Finland also adopted this model. Together, they then took a further step, creating an independent organisation that would form the backbone of the [payments ecosystem](https://www.financedigest.com/the-future-of-payments-biometrics-within-the-financial-ecosystem.html "The Future of Payments: Biometrics Within the Financial Ecosystem") across the Nordics.

This greatly simplified and reduced the cost of daily operations for the many Nordic banks [issuing international](https://www.financedigest.com/a-taxing-issue-ten-tax-invoicing-pitfalls-that-international-businesses-must-avoid.html "A taxing issue: Ten tax invoicing pitfalls that international businesses must avoid") and domestic card schemes, from Visa and MasterCard to Dankort in Denmark and BankAxept in Norway. Instead of having to [invest heavily in building](https://www.financedigest.com/increase-in-investments-in-building-refurbishment-and-new-construction-activities-to-propel-demand-of-construction-safety-net-market-fact-mr-report.html "Increase in Investments in Building Refurbishment and New Construction Activities to Propel Demand of Construction Safety Net Market: Fact.MR Report") in-house systems and competences, Nordic issuers tap into an existing feature and service-rich infrastructure which includes card processing services. This enables them to take advantage of both greater efficiency and more [revenue opportunity](https://www.financedigest.com/the-potential-impact-of-coronavirus-covid-19-for-riveting-tools-market-revenue-opportunity-forecast-and-value-chain-2021-2028.html "The Potential Impact Of Coronavirus (Covid-19) For Riveting Tools Market Revenue, Opportunity, Forecast And Value Chain 2021-2028"), without the capital investment or operational expenditures conventionally required.

**That was 50 years ago – what about now?**

The rapid evolution of the card [payments industry](https://www.financedigest.com/end-of-year-overview-of-the-payments-industry.html "End of year overview of the payments industry") has only increased the value of outsourcing core business processes. As new technologies impacting banking and financial services are developed, the only certainty is that [consumers’ expectations](https://www.financedigest.com/keeping-up-with-heightened-consumer-expectations-in-financial-services.html "Keeping up with heightened consumer expectations in financial services") of their banks will continue to get higher. By enabling issuers to plug into outsourced [digital and mobile payment](https://www.financedigest.com/why-anti-spoofing-fingerprint-technology-is-essential-for-the-continued-growth-of-digital-payments.html "Why anti-spoofing fingerprint technology is essential for the continued growth of digital payments") services, this independent infrastructure gives them the means to respond quickly to changing customer expectations, launch innovative new products and services, defend against disintermediation from new players and strengthen customer relationships. This enables issuers to create new end-to-end [digital customer](https://www.financedigest.com/the-cervical-total-disc-replacement-market-to-grow-based-on-customized-digitization.html "The Cervical Total Disc Replacement Market to grow based on customized digitization") experiences faster and more efficiently than they could achieve alone.

The independent card processing outsourcer is also the most widely integrated issuing [service provider in the Nordic markets](https://www.financedigest.com/sleep-service-providers-market-report.html "Sleep Service Providers Market Report"), which enables issuers to build cross-country partnerships in the Nordic and Baltic markets by connecting directly to all leading acquirers. This capability opens the door to the rapid development of new, innovative and revenue generating issuing services that can be quickly brought to [market and improve consumers’ banking](https://www.financedigest.com/improving-reputation-in-the-banking-sector-through-marketing-communications.html "IMPROVING REPUTATION IN THE BANKING SECTOR THROUGH MARKETING COMMUNICATIONS") and payment experiences.

**Could this be replicated internationally?**

In short, yes. Despite the unique historical circumstances, the Nordics are a success story for what [banks can achieve through outsourcing](https://www.financedigest.com/in-a-rising-market-are-banking-outsourcers-pulling-their-weight.html "In a rising market, are banking outsourcers pulling their weight?") not just secondary functions, but core business operations such as card processing. Issuers need easy, stable and [secure services](https://www.financedigest.com/facilitating-open-finance-through-secure-services.html "Facilitating open finance through secure services") every time a cardholder makes a payment, while at the same time being able to concentrate on innovating to benefit their customers. This has been realised in the Nordics, leading to faster time-to-market for banking products and services and, as such, a digitally ready population en-route to [leaving cash behind](https://www.financedigest.com/new-research-reveals-the-countries-leaving-cash-behind.html "New research reveals the countries leaving cash behind") forever.

The [demand for specialised capabilities will continue to grow as technologies](https://www.financedigest.com/computer-assisted-anesthesia-systems-market-industry-analysis-opportunities-technology-demand-top-players-and-growth-forecast-2027.html "Computer Assisted Anesthesia Systems Market Industry Analysis, Opportunities, Technology, Demand, Top Players and Growth Forecast 2027") such as AI, biometrics and VR flood the financial services market. By outsourcing core functions, issuers across the world can become increasingly agile and empowered to focus on their [customers’ journey](https://www.financedigest.com/how-to-navigate-a-seamless-journey-from-cio-to-chief-customer-officer.html "How to navigate a seamless journey from CIO to Chief Customer Officer").
